Output f42634b2cb108b53fabf7fa6ccaab31695a4b6da3e94568a3f497c67f5fc9e8a:3

value
43423985
script pubkey
OP_0 OP_PUSHBYTES_20 62380659c8d01efc555d1ef8ea273501666ee58e
address
tb1qvguqvkwg6q00c42armuw5fe4q9nxaevwnu8x0y
transaction
f42634b2cb108b53fabf7fa6ccaab31695a4b6da3e94568a3f497c67f5fc9e8a